Something that sparks between modern and classic - Neoclassicism

Neoclassical interior design rooted in art history since the 18 century. During this period, a movement wanted to move away from the superficial nature of Baroque and Rococo designs. Each design intention reflects people’s social status down through the ages. Material selection speaks

Bronze, velvet, fabulous wallpapers and neoclassical architectural features are the main elements in Neoclassicism. Designer perfectly plays these elements around by details. You can discover the highlight of bronze appears on the ceiling cornices, lighting and selected coffee table. Fine bronze patterns are harmoniously aligned throughout all wallpapers and marble tiles. A soft balancing touch with textures.
